The MV2 is engineered to be the lightest and most efficient Natural Running shoe ever produced. The race-specific second generation Action/Reaction Technology provides greater protection for running on hard surfaces. With a level to the ground profile (zero pitch) and a unique biomechanical sensor plate, the foot can sense the ground quicker, allowing for a fast-paced cadence. This shoe inspires speed.
Adjusting to a zero-pitch shoe
Adjusting to a completely level shoe requires time. At a mere 5.8 ounces, its lifespan is between 150 and 250 miles, depending on form and efficiency.
It is not unusual for runners who are transitioning to a zero-drop shoe like the MV2 to experience tightness in the calf muscles and achilles tendons, as well as the feet. This can occur because the muscles and tendons are further elongated when running in a zero-drop shoe, compared to a conventional shoe with a higher heel.
Adapting to a zero-drop shoe and a natural running style take time and the process is unique for each athlete. It is always best to make the transition gradually. With this in mind, Newton has enclosed a removable 3 millimeter heel lift with each pair of MV2's in the event that you wish to transition with incremental steps. This is particularly recommended if you are transitioning from a shoe with a high heel-toe drop.
